Hyundai has officially unveiled the all-new 2021 Hyundai i20. The small hatchback will be showcased during the 2020 Geneva Motor Show, the event which will kick off on March 3rd.

As you would expect, the new i20 comes with some exterior bits that are currently found on the i30 model. We can see a new grille, edgy lines, a new design for the headlights and of course, new spoilers. All in all, the i20 comes with a cleaner look and this is good for the Asian car manufacturer.

The interior of the new 2021 Hyundai i20 gains some new and interesting stuff. One of the most important one is the 10.25 inch digital instrument cluster which can be combined with a 10.25 inch touchscreen display for the infotainment system.

The car will feature wireless cell phone charging, Apple CarPlay and Android Auto and an eight speaker Bose cound system.

Under the hood of the new 2021 Hyundai i20 will be a 1.2 liter petrol unit with 83 horsepower and a five speed transmission. The second option is a 1.0 liter turbo unit which can be ordered in 99 HP or 118 horsepower version. According to Hyundai, this motor can be ordered with a 48V system. Customers will be able to pick a seven speed dual clutch transmission.
